Why raised garden beds are a game-changer for every gardener
Raised beds deliver a powerful combination of improved soil conditions, better drainage, and easier access that benefits both beginning and experienced gardeners. By elevating the planting area above native soil, raised beds warm up faster in spring and allow roots to breathe, encouraging vigorous growth and higher yields. For ornamental plantings, raised flower beds create a defined, tidy look that frames paths and patios while protecting delicate blooms from foot traffic and mowing.
Soil composition can be precisely controlled in a raised bed, making it simpler to provide the ideal mix of nutrients, drainage, and structure for vegetables, herbs, or perennials. That control translates to fewer weeds and less compaction, which means less time spent maintaining and more time harvesting. Accessibility is another major advantage: higher bed walls reduce bending and kneeling, which makes gardening an option for older adults and people with limited mobility. Incorporating wide edge boards creates comfortable seating for longer planting sessions.
Material choice matters. While traditional wooden beds offer a natural look, many gardeners now prefer durable alternatives like metal raised garden beds for their longevity and modern aesthetic. Metal beds resist rot and pests and often come in modular systems that make assembly simple. Regardless of material, choosing the right depth—usually 12–18 inches for most vegetables and deeper for root crops—ensures plants have sufficient room for robust root systems. Proper planning around bed placement, sun exposure, and companion planting strategies maximizes success and helps craft a low-maintenance, high-yield garden space.
How to plan, build, and maintain raised beds for long-term success
Planning is essential before putting soil into any raised bed. Start by mapping sun patterns and selecting a location with at least six hours of direct sunlight for most vegetables. Consider proximity to a water source and ease of access for tools and harvesting. Standard beds are often 3–4 feet wide to allow reaching the center from either side without stepping on the soil. For small yards or balconies, narrow and shallow beds can still grow herbs and compact varieties of vegetables.
Construction options range from purpose-built kits to DIY solutions using reclaimed wood, cedar, stone, or galvanized steel. When selecting materials, balance aesthetics, budget, and longevity: cedar resists rot naturally while galvanized steel provides a contemporary look with near-indestructible performance. Filling the bed requires layered thinking—start with a small layer of coarse material for drainage if needed, then add a high-quality mix of compost, topsoil, and organic matter tailored to the plants. Mulch the surface to conserve moisture and suppress weeds.
Maintenance routines for raised beds are straightforward: regular watering (often more frequent than in-ground beds), seasonal soil amendments with compost, and periodic crop rotation to prevent disease buildup.
